why lift for a kickstand job? put block of wood in front of front tire and to rear of rear tire. go to your ceiling and screw in a 99 cent J hook. mark center of top triple clamp on ceiling and install each hook outward 16 inches from center mark. run a tie down from each hook to rope or soft strap attached to each grip wrapped around soft cloth. now X the tie downs. in other words left hook holds right side and right hook holds left. cinch up the tie downs till bike centered and you have it. works like a charm everytime. ya....i know.....landlord doesn't want **** screwed into his ceiling.:D
